Toki Tori - #1 Video (1:21)
Two Tribes | Nintendo | Other | Published on 19 May 2008 | Video Length: 1:21 | Wii
Toki Tori Videos
Other Videos
See/Add Comments
Two Tribes | Nintendo | Other | Published on 19 May 2008 | Video Length: 1:21 | Wii